History

The civilian CHEOS (China High-resolution Earth Observation System) satellite program was proposed in 2006 and received approval in 2010. Gaofen 1 was the first of six planned CHEOS spacecraft for being launched between 2013 and 2016. The satellite's primary goal is to provide near real time observations for disaster prevention and relief, climate change monitoring, geographical mapping,
